19-year-old Maximilian Ibrahimović, the son of Zlatan, recently left Milan and AC Milan to play for Ajax. At the weekend, Ibrahimović scored two goals as second-team Jong Ajax played a friendly against FC Eindhoven. The final score was 4-1 to Ibrahimović’s team.
Maximilian Ibrahimović recently joined the club on loan with an option to buy. So far, he has had one appearance in the Dutch second division, the Eerste Divisie, where the second team is last in the table.
There is now talk of lifting Maximilian Ibrahimović up to the first team sooner than initially planned.
